Nuclear cardiology is a branch of nuclear medicine used to diagnose and treat heart disease. Using radioactive materials, doctors use nuclear imaging tests to evaluate the structure and function of your heart’s tissues and cells. Nuclear cardiology is performed at Riverview Health.
